Pacman: The Board Game

The idea of the project was to create a new game inspired by the video Game Pacman. Thinking about the mechanics and the style of game.
We got inspired by the Brazilian game Curral that relies on the player trying to get to the other side of the board and at the same time get in the way of the opponents by creating barriers.
The board is a big square of 30 x 30 Cm filled with tiny squares of 2 x 2 Cm.
The pieces of the game are the same characters as in the video game. Each Player is a Pacman and on each small square in the board, there is a small ball. Each ball is one point. To win the game the player has to pick as many balls as he/she can.
The player can only move according to which number he got on the dice. The dice has the number one in two sides, the number two and the number three, this means that the maximum movement of one player is three squares. For each square that he walks by, he collects the balls that lie there. The other two sides are the ghosts. If a player rolls the dice and the ghost appears, he has to pick one ghost of the pile and place it on one small square on the board. That place now is blocked, the ball that was there is out of the game and no one can step on that square anymore. You can place the ghost wherever you like but it cant be on the square that the other player already is or block any path for other players (you can't create a square of ghosts around your opponent and block him from the game for example).
The game ends when the balls end.
After testing this prototype of paper we realized that the pieces would fly very easily if they where loose on the table. So for the final product we crated a magnetized table where the balls and the Pacmans are made from magnets and the board is metal.
